Creator of a virtuoso and innovative style within the flamenco world, Israel Galván, is nowadays universally recognized as the most important performer of flamenco. He developed a beauty that significantly combines two approaches, contemporary and traditional.
‘Vicente Escudero’ Award at Concurso Nacional de Arte Flamenco di Córdoba (1995); ‘El Desplante’ Award at the Festival Internacional del Cante de las Minas di La Unión (1996); awarded at ‘I Concurso de Jóvenes Interpretes’ at the IX Biennial of Flamenco of Siviglia (1996); awarded Flamenco ‘Hoy’ as best dancer by the critics (2001 e 2005); ‘Giraldillo’ Award as best performer of Baile at XIII Biennial of Flamenco of Siviglia (2004); national award for dance in ‘Creazione’ category assigned by Culture Spanish Minister; Grand Prix de Danse 2009-2010 (France); MAX Award as best dancer assigned by Spanish Society Authors and Editors (2011); MAX Award as best dancer and best choreography (2012); Bessie Award (New York, 2012); Gold Medal from Spanish Ministers Council (2012).
